Output 51523e6863d2031496c77c30f1475d51c9ca76b36a8405fb00d8c1ccc167da9b:1

value
2617031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be5b2e3b0e9c34879043d0931235400e8a539869 OP_EQUAL
address
3K3XYL62kA4CXhNueKz6KCJD9XkzTWef4X
transaction
51523e6863d2031496c77c30f1475d51c9ca76b36a8405fb00d8c1ccc167da9b
spent
true